Understanding What a Cooker Hood Is
A cooker hood is a kitchen appliance that removes smoke, steam, grease, and cooking odors from the air. It is installed above the stove or cooking area and works by pulling polluted air through filters. After filtering, the air is either released outside or cleaned and returned to the kitchen. Different Types of Cooker Hoods Available
There are several types of cooker hoods to suit different kitchen layouts and styles. Wall-mounted cooker hoods are installed directly on the wall above the stove. They are popular because they combine strong performance with attractive design.

Under-cabinet cooker hoods are placed beneath kitchen cabinets. These models save space and are ideal for smaller kitchens. They provide basic ventilation while keeping a low profile.

Island cooker hoods are designed for kitchens with cooking islands. These hoods hang from the ceiling and provide ventilation in open spaces. They often become a visual centerpiece in modern kitchens.

Integrated cooker hoods are hidden inside cabinets. They are perfect for homeowners who prefer a clean and minimal kitchen appearance.

Choosing The right Size And Power
Selecting the correct size is important for effective ventilation. The cooker hood should be at least as wide as the stove or cooktop. A wider hood offers better coverage and captures more smoke and steam.

Power is measured by airflow capacity. Higher airflow is useful for heavy cooking and large kitchens. However, more power can also mean more noise. Many modern cooker hoods include multiple fan speeds so users can adjust airflow based on cooking needs.

It is also important to consider ceiling height and kitchen layout. These factors affect how well the cooker hood performs.

Installation And Ventilation Options
Cooker hoods can be installed using two main ventilation methods. External venting sends air outside through ducts. This method is very effective at removing heat and strong odors.

Recirculating systems use filters to clean the air and then release it back into the kitchen. This option is useful when external ducting is not possible, such as in apartments or rented homes.

Proper installation is important for safety and performance. Professional installation is often recommended to ensure correct placement, secure mounting, and safe electrical connections.

Maintenance And Cleaning Tips
Regular maintenance keeps a cooker hood working efficiently. Grease filters should be cleaned or replaced according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Clean filters allow better airflow and reduce fire risk.

The outer surface should be wiped regularly to remove grease and dust. Stainless steel surfaces benefit from special cleaning products that prevent streaks and fingerprints.

Checking the fan motor and lights occasionally helps identify small problems early. Simple maintenance routines can greatly extend the life of the appliance.

Common Mistakes To avoid When Buying
One common mistake is choosing a cooker hood based only on appearance. While design is important, performance and airflow should always come first.

Another mistake is ignoring noise levels. Some powerful models can be loud, which may be uncomfortable in smaller kitchens. Checking noise ratings before buying can help avoid this issue.

Not measuring the kitchen space properly can also lead to installation problems. Always check dimensions and ventilation requirements before making a purchase.
